Europe's main stock markets were steady in opening deals on Friday, with London's FTSE 100 benchmark index of leading shares up 0.10 percent at 5,946.62 points. In Paris the CAC 40 gained just 0.03 percent to 3,581.45 points and Frankfurt's DAX 30 won a marginal 0.02 percent to 7,145.78 points. Asian markets traded mixed on Friday as another batch of upbeat US data was tempered by lingering concerns over rising oil prices and China's slowing economy. Wall Street had posted modest gains on Thursday as investors digested a batch of economic data that suggested the US recovery is picking up steam.
